Excise taxes are a type of tax that is imposed on the manufacture, sale, or use of certain goods and services. They are often used to help fund government projects and services, and can be a significant source of revenue for governments. The first step in maximizing benefits and opportunities under excise tax regulations is to understand the different types of excise taxes. Excise taxes are generally divided into two categories: ad valorem taxes and specific taxes. Ad valorem taxes are based on the value of the goods or services being taxed, while specific taxes are based on the quantity of the goods or services being taxed. In some cases, taxes may also be based on the type of goods or services being taxed.
